599CN.COM - 【源码之家】老牌网站源码下载站,提供完整商业网站源码下载!

thinkphp 根目录的作用和结构

源码网2023-08-01 22:17:35236ThinkPHP目录thinkphp文件

了解thinkphp 根目录的作用和结构

thinkphp根目录是thinkphp框架中的一个重要组成部分,它在整个应用程序中扮演着关键的角色。根目录包含了框架的核心文件和必要的目录结构,为开发者提供了一个良好的工作环境。

thinkphp 根目录的作用和结构

1. 根目录的结构分析

thinkphp根目录主要包含以下几个重要的文件和目录:

  • app目录:应用程序的核心目录,包含了各个模块、控制器和模板文件。

  • thinkphp目录:框架核心文件的存放位置,包括了路由、数据库、缓存等功能模块。

  • public目录:公开访问的静态资源文件存放的目录,如CSS、JavaScript和图片等。

  • think文件:框架的入口文件,定义了整个应用程序的运行流程。

  • composer.json:Composer包管理器的配置文件,用于引入和管理第三方库。

2. 根目录的作用

thinkphp根目录承载着框架的核心功能和目录结构设计,具有以下几个重要作用:

  • 组织应用程序的核心文件和目录,易于理解和维护。

  • 提供了框架的入口文件和核心库,方便开发者对应用程序进行配置和扩展。

  • 规范了应用程序的目录结构,使得团队合作开发更高效、统一。

  • 保护重要文件和敏感信息,限制对外访问。

使用指南:配置和创建thinkphp 根目录

1. 配置thinkphp根目录

在部署和使用thinkphp时,需要进行一些必要的配置。

  • 将框架的根目录放置在Web服务器的根目录下,以确保可以直接访问。

  • 根据实际需求,对think文件进行配置,比如设置URL重写规则等。

  • 根据项目需要,配置composer.json文件,引入所需的第三方库。

2. 创建thinkphp根目录

要创建一个新的thinkphp根目录,按照以下步骤进行:

  • 下载thinkphp框架的最新版本,解压到Web服务器的根目录中。

  • 配置框架相关的设置,比如数据库信息、缓存配置等。

  • 根据项目需求,创建自己的应用目录和模块文件。

  • 在public目录下,放置静态资源文件和入口文件。

3. 使用thinkphp根目录的注意事项

在使用thinkphp根目录时,需要注意以下几点:

  • 根据框架版本,及时更新和升级框架,以获得更好的功能和性能。

  • 及时备份根目录及其相关文件,以防数据丢失或系统故障。

  • 合理设置权限控制,限制对根目录和重要文件的访问。

  • 遵循thinkphp官方文档推荐的目录结构和代码规范。

通过本文对thinkphp 根目录的详细介绍,相信您已经对该目录的作用和使用有了较为全面的了解。在实际开发中,合理使用和配置根目录,可以为您的项目提供稳定的基础和良好的扩展性。祝您在使用thinkphp框架时取得圆满的开发成果!

转载声明:本站发布文章及版权归原作者所有,转载本站文章请注明文章来源!

本文链接:https://599cn.com/post/21380.html